March in Nafpaktos brings a dynamic blend of weather, with temperatures reaching a maximum of 23°C (73°F) and dipping to a minimum of -2°C (29°F), resulting in an average of 9°C (49°F). The month is characterized by its moderate precipitation, totaling 104 mm (4.1 in) over approximately 13 days, creating a humid environment with an average relative humidity of 75%. This combination of warmth and moisture makes March an intriguing time for visitors, allowing them to experience the region's shifting climate while enjoying the early signs of spring.

March in Nafpaktos marks a transition in the precipitation pattern, with 104 mm (4.1 in) of rain falling over 13 days, indicating a continuation of the wet season as winter gives way to spring. Compared to January and February, which see heavier rainfall (164 mm and 123 mm, respectively), March experiences a noticeable decline in precipitation. However, it still holds significant moisture before the drier months ahead. As April approaches, rainfall drops further to 60 mm (2.4 in), setting the stage for sunnier days in May. As March unfolds in Nafpaktos, Greece, humidity levels begin to show a noticeable decline, dropping to 75% from the 78% experienced in February. This gradual decrease in moisture is a precursor to the drier months ahead, with April seeing a further dip to 70%. As spring unfolds in Nafpaktos, Greece, the UV Index rises steadily, marking a significant shift in sun exposure. In March, the UV Index reaches 6, indicating a high level of ultraviolet radiation, with a burn time of just 25 minutes for fair-skinned individuals. This trend of increasing UV intensity signposts the approaching summer months, where April escalates to an 8, and May peaks at 10—both categorized as very high exposure risks. As March unfolds in Nafpaktos, Greece, the days bask in a notable increase of 328 hours of sunshine, setting the stage for the vibrant warmth of spring. This uptick follows the milder months of January and February, which recorded 203 and 260 hours respectively. The trend continues upward as April shines even brighter with 342 hours, reflecting the growing anticipation for the summer ahead. As March arrives in Nafpaktos, Greece, daylight begins to noticeably extend, peeking at 11 hours of sunlight by the end of the month. This transition marks a gradual shift from the shorter winter days of January and February, which offered only 9 and 10 hours of daylight, respectively. The lengthening days are a precursor to the vibrant spring and summer months, where April claims 13 hours, followed by May and June, each basking in 14 hours of sun.
